It would be good if someone who played this build could choose Scion Ascendancy, take Deadeye (and maybe Berserker for the Leech, to free a gem slot) and test it again (using non-legacy gear including jewels).

Unfortunately this build is a rather large investment and I don't want to do that this early in the league (sacrificial harvest jewels etc.), currently I am playing a very similar build to do ES based Storm Call in SC Perandus. (just left out all the Increased Duration nodes including the jewel on the left side of the tree, added Area/Damage nodes at Witch start for Storm Call).

I did not try to go Vaal Spark yet as Spark alone does not feel very good to play (switched to Storm Call very early, as Spark was pretty random and slow even with Orb of Storms), had no Deadeye Ascendancy from Scion that early though.

What kept me from trying to go Vaal Spark at the moment is the duration reduction of the spiral (the time how long those sparks are coming out of the character).
Paired with the immense need of souls needs a HUGE investment and you probably are still not able to keep it up for farming now. (but as I said, someone would have to test it in at least dried lake with the gear and the new pierce gem as well as Scion Ascendancy Deadeye class!)

I don't mind the damage/crit nerf, as Increased Critical Strikes is extremely potent (and you can spare that gem slot as you don't need life leech anymore with Berserker Ascendancy) and Pierce also gives damage now - with the Deadeye Ascendant it is exactly 100% pierce chance.
So damage will not be a problem, more likely that the duration (which unfortunately cannot be affected by increased duration gem or nodes - at least if it didn't changed) killed the build.
I speced out of Scion Pathfinder Ascendancy into Deadeye Ascendancy and went Vaal Spark.
Unfortunately I did not want to afford several Sacrificial Harvest Jewels as they are 1 Ex or more per piece - which makes it really expensive.

So currently I only have 1 Sacrificial Harvest (29%) and 1 Chill of Corruption, so I don't have Vaal Spark all the time.

This is my current tree:

I just removed all the unnecessary Increased Duration nodes, as they provide literally nothing to the build (in my oppinion). Although I made it purely to farm Dried Lake, so I am not going into higher maps at the moment (and in Dried Lake, Vaal Spark kills everything including Voll so fast that he do not even get to smash or whatever).

Rest of my jewels are just adding Energy Shield, resistances and stats (my resistances are currently not fully capped due to Call of the Brotherhood and Eye of Chayula, Also my ES is currently pretty low - but in Dried Lake it doesn't really matter.



I am pretty sure if I had 2-3 more Sacrificial Harvest jewels I could keep Vaal Spark up all the time. The biggest pain for it are small rocks or other obstacles that prevent whirling blades from happening, thus wasting time.

But imho Vaal Spark is far from dead imho.
